OshKosh B'Gosh Operating Chief Passes Away

Mike Wachtel was 48

OshKosh B'Gosh, Inc. (Oshkosh, Wis.) has announced that Mike Wachtel, executive vp and coo, died May 25, 2002, following a long battle with cancer. Mr. Wachtel was 48 at the time of his death.

David Omachinski, vp, cfo and treasurer, will add Wachtel's role as executive vp and coo. William Wyman, vp of domestic licensing, has been promoted to senior vp of global licensing. Paul Lowry, vp of corporate retail, has been appointed to replace Wachtel on the board of directors.

Lowry has held the position of vp of corporate retail at the company since 1994, responsible for all retail store operations and the company's e-commerce business. He had previously spent three years as vp of retail operations for Essex Outfitters, Inc., at the time a wholly owned subsidiary of OshKosh B'Gosh. Before that, he had held several retail management positions with the Woolworth Co. The Little Folks Shop.

“All of us are deeply saddened by the untimely loss of our friend and colleague,” said chairman, president and ceo Douglas Hyde. “Throughout Mike's tenure with the company, his contributions to our success were immeasurable. His enthusiasm, hard work and dedication will be truly missed.”

OshKosh B'Gosh produces and sells its trademark overalls, plus other apparel, car seats, strollers, toys and kids'bedding (some made by licensees), through about 4340 stores in the U.S. and abroad plus about 140 outlet and specialty stores of its own.
